Output 5cc63dac4309176e65304d1daac2e95955d782a6dfa96f5ef8c040fe8e2b7333:0

value
10628574
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e56ace2614d2749421c1827519314fda0e72378b OP_EQUAL
address
3Nc4cS58WAbY9W4eTq5Y5rxwHaSC8CTCfL
transaction
5cc63dac4309176e65304d1daac2e95955d782a6dfa96f5ef8c040fe8e2b7333
confirmations
428616
spent
true

2 Sat Ranges